Back in August 2019 Hasbro announced a company wide initiative to remove plastic from all of their toy packaging by the end of 2022. For many of their products this likely won't be that difficult to do, however when it comes to the world of collectible action figures like say Marvel Legends, that isn't as easy as it sounds. You see many, at least those who still do their primary figure buying at physical stores, as opposed to online want to be able to see the figures they buy before handing their cash over. This is for a number of reasons. One is so they can pick the figure with the best paint applications, since all figures aren't created equally when they ship from the overseas factories. Another reason people want to see the figure they are buying is to make sure it's the actual one listed on the packaging. You see an all to common problem that has developed in the hobby is the act of figure swapping. This is when someone decides to switch out an old figure with the new one and then put it back on the pegs. Usually these people will buy the figure, go home switch out the new figure with an old one and then take it back as a return. The stores who have know idea what the actual figure in the box should be take it, and then eventually put it back on their shelves to be resold. If one can't see the figure inside the packaging, then they have no way of knowing if a figure swapper has gotten to before they have. Recently Hasbro has been selling army builder Marvel Legends figures which are sold exclusively online. These figures come in a unique closed box that features nice artwork on the outside. This packaging is totally comprised of cardboard, and has no plastic on it. The boxes are smaller than regular Marvel Legends packaging and the figures cost about $5 cheaper. So is this something Hasbro could switch the entire line over to? Dan Yun from the Hasbro Marvel brand team poses a question not to long ago on social media asking what people thought about the closed box troop builder packages... Was this just a random question Dan posed because he was bored, or was he trying to do some research, getting customer feeback about the new packaging? Most of the responses he got seemed to totally ignore the packaging aspect of his question, as people instead honed in on the troop builder aspect of it. Still this got me wondering, could they be considering this style of packaging for the entire Marvel Legends line? Is it at all practical for a mass retail produced action figure line? For myself, I have no problem if they went to a closed box style for their action figures. I think modifications would need to be made to make it more difficult to take the figure out of the box and put a different one back in, but otherwise I would be fine with it. Of course I do most of my figure shopping online these days, and I open all my figures, so packaging to me is just something that goes into the garbage. In a tale of what could have been, toy designer David Vonner who has previously worked at both Hasbro and Mattel recently revealed that years ago he purposed an idea of doing a Marvel, DC, Hasbro, Mattel SDCC collaboration where a action figure boxset would be created based on the classic 1982 Chris Claremont The Uncanny X-Men and The New Teen Titans comic book which was done as a cross-company publication between Marvel and DC Comics. Dave didn't specify which company he was working for when he purposed the idea or for what scale, 6" or 4". He said the idea was to do the boxset as a San Diego Comic Con exclusive with all proceeds going to charity. He said the idea was shot down without blinking an eye, so its probably safe to say there was never much of a chance for this becoming a reality. While not yet officially revealed by Hasbro, their second wave of 3.75" Marvel Legends Retro figures have started to see release along with wave 1 figures at Target stores in CA. The wave includes news figures of Elektra, Iceman and Daredevil along with Black Panther, Classic Iron Man and Electro. The latter 3 figures had been previously released last year as part of the HasbroPulse exclusive 2-packs. You can check out images of the figures below via MCUCollector. Each figure is $9.99. Starting sometime next month the figures should be available everywhere, but for now Target is the place to look for them if you want to add these to your collection.

Ok so lets start off going over everything that has yet to be released, but has been "OFFICIALLY" confirmed by Hasbro. Truthfully this is the smaller portion of the article, since recently by the time Hasbro gets around to announcing it, it starts seeing release. Things like the Spider-Man Stiltman BAF wave, Deluxe Thanos and Firestar figures that Hasbro only announced a short time ago have already started showing up. Hell you may recall that the Avengers Mr. Fixit BAF wave started hitting shelves a week after Hasbro announced it. The two most recent items to show up are the Firestar and Deluxe Thanos figures. You can check out our first review of Firestar HERE. And our first review of the new Deluxe Thanos HERE. So probably the next thing we can expect to start showing up is the newly announced X-Men House Of X Tri-Sentinel wave. This wave includes figures based on the House Of X/Power of X Marvel Comics story-line. The figures in the wave are as follows: Professor X figure -Pair of alternate hands -Alternate head sculpt -BAF Piece Cyclops figure -Alternate head sculpt -Blast effect -BAF Piece Magneto figure -2 Pairs of alternate hands -BAF Piece Jean Grey figure -Pair of alternate hands -Krakoan flower pod -BAF Piece Moira MacTaggert figure -Pair of alternate arms -Alternate head sculpt -Book -Scarf -BAF Piece Omega Sentinel figure -Alternate head sculpt -Pair of alternate forearms -BAF Piece Wolverine figure -Alternate head sculpt The Build-A-Figure is the Tri-Sentinel. You can pre-order these now from our sponsor BigBadToyStore.com. Hasbro has also confirmed that they will be releasing a Marvel Legends 6" Mega Deluxe M.O.D.O.K. figure that will cost $50. This is the most expensive Deluxe figure Hasbro has done to date. This one is also available for pre-order at our sponsor BigBadToyStore.com. For exclusives we know that there will be a new Deadpool 2 Movie burned version coming to Amazon in March. You can still pre-order that one through our Amazon affiliate link. Walgreens in the US and EB Games in Canada will be getting a new Fallen Silver Surfer figure coming in early Spring. That one has yet to go up for pre-order. Hasbro also revealed that the theme for this years Walgreens exclusives would be a "Cosmic" one. Following the Silver Surfer will be a new Classic NOVA figure. What follows NOVA remains unknown at this time. Beyond that, Hasbro has given us a few hints/teases for whats to come. We know there will be a new sculpted figure that will have a tail coming. My GUESS for that is an updated Tigra figure, but I really have absolutely no idea on that one. Since they specifically used the words newly sculpted figure in their clue, that suggests to me that this will be a new updated figure of one already released as opposed to a figure of a character never released before. Hasbro also told us that we will be seeing a Cannonball figure with legs in 2021. It's unknown if this will be the same X-Force figure we just got, only with legs as opposed to the blast-off effect, or something else entirely. Maybe a New Mutants version??? Hasbro also revealed that we will be getting a new Classic Ultron figure sometime in 2021. I will be talking more about that one down below in the RUMOR portion of the article. Finally Hasbro has confirmed that they are doing an all-villains "Bring On The Bad Guys" wave this year. The three figures officially confirmed for this wave include Arcade, Dormammu and A.I.M.'s Scientist Supreme. Ok so that brings us to the UNOFFICIAL RUMOR portion of the article. Nothing beyond this point has been OFFICIALLY CONFIRMED by Hasbro. That being said, I personally feel pretty confident in these rumors being legit, otherwise I wouldn't be presenting them to you. Still as I always say, until Hasbro does officially confirm this stuff, well you know. So lets start things off by going back to that Classic Ultron figure we know is coming. While Hasbro didn't tell us how or where it would be released, my info suggests it will be part of a new Iron Man themed wave. The Build-A-Figure for the wave is not known at this time, but the regular figures in the wave look to include the following: - Classic Ultron - Darkstar (Unknown if this will feature her classic look or a more modern one) - Iron Man Modular Armor - Iron Heart - Guardsman (My info was not clear if this will be just a regular classic Guardsman or possibly a more specific version like maybe Curtis Elkins who was part of The Jury. Granted the Sentry version would seemingly be more fitting for a Venom themed wave, but we will have to see.) Hologram - (The assumption is that this will be an Iron Man figure, possibly the more modern Model 68 version.) Iron Man Stealth - (There have been several versions of the Stealth Armor featured in the comics over the years, and I have no idea which specific one the figure will actually be based on. My best guess would be that they will repaint the recent Alex Ross Iron Man figure with stealth colors, but we will have to wait and see.) Lets also finish up what I think will be the remaining three figures in the Bring On The Bad Guys wave. Again the Build-A-Figure is unknown, but the regular figures in the wave look to include Arcade, Dormammu, A.I.M.'s Scientist Supreme, Hydra Supreme, Lady Deathstrike, the Hood and Victor Von Doom. The exact versions we will get for some of these like Hydra Supreme and Victor Von Doom are UNKNOWN. Last year Hasbro released a Retro Fantastic Four Doctor Doom figure as a single release. There should be a full wave of Fantastic Four Retro figures coming in 2021, however I don't have any specific details on what figures will be included at this time. Now on to the Movie and TV stuff, much of which was originally supposed to be released in 2020, but got delayed due to the Pandemic. If you want to AVOID ANY KIND OF MOVIE/TV SPOILERS, then you should STOP reading here. While Hasbro hasn't officially confirmed the figures for the MCU Eternals movie wave, we know what they are, because images of the figures have already leaked out. This wave was originally slated for released this past summer but got pushed when the movie did. The Eternals movie is now slated with a November 5, 2021 release, which means we probably won't officially see these figures on shelves until we get closer to that date. The regular wave of figures which you can check out images of HERE will include the following: - Ikaris who will be played by actor Richard Madden - Sersi who will be played by actress Gemma Chan - Makkari who will be played by actress Lauren Ridloff - Sprite who will be played by actress Lia McHugh - Phastos who will be played by actor Brian Tyree Henry - Kingo who will be played by actor Kumail Nanjiani - Druig who will be played by actor Barry Keoghan The Build-A-Figure will be Gilgamesh. We also know there will be a Deluxe Eternals Kro figure, and some kind of store exclusive single release of Ajak. Hasbro has pretty much said we can expect a wave of figures for the upcoming Shang-Chi: And The Legend Of The Ten Rings movie, but hasb't given us any details about what figures we will see in it. Youtuber rektangular first reported, which I have seen additional info to further confirm, the wave will include the following figures: -Shang-Chi -Civil Warrior -Death Dealer -Iron Man -Leiku Wu -Mei Ling Shang-Chi, Leiku Wu and Mei Ling are all speculated to be movie based while the rest will likely be comic based. Once again the Build-A-Figure for the wave is unknown. There should also be at least 1, though likely 2 waves of Disney+ themed Marvel figures coming in 2021. The first wave which we will likely see around June time frame is slated to include the following: - USAgent - Loki - Baron Zemo - Scarlet Witch - Vision - Winter Soldier - Captain America Captain America is likely going to be Falcon, and no word on what the Build-A-Figure will be. Last year you may recall Hasbro released as Pulse exclusives some Retro 3.75" Marvel Legends that were based on the concept of "What If" Kenner had done Marvel figures back in the day. The figures themselves have around 5 points of articulation and they come on Retro like cardbacks. Well now Hasbro is releasing more as single carded figures at regular retail. Well they will start off at Target stores in March and then see a more general release in April. Each figure costs $9.99. The figures shown below include Hulk, Human Torch, Captain Marvel, Spider-Man, Captain America and Magento.

Shown below via Troycollectstoys are in-hand images for the new 6" Marvel Legends Silver Surfer (Fallen One) figure from Hasbro. The figure has started arriving at EBGames in Canada for those who pre-ordered the figure. In Canada the figure is an EBGames exclusive. Here in the US the figure will be released as a Walgreens exclusive, however Walgreens at this time has not made it available for pre-order and no word yet on when it will see release. The SKU# is 758028. The figure is based on "The Fallen One" storyline from the comics. Its a repaint of the previous Silver Surfer Hasbro released a few years ago with a darker metallic silver paint, surf board and also includes a blast effect and Mjolnir which is from the storyline.
